[csw-users] evince crashes after several CTRL-R (refresh)
Gerard Henry
ghenry at cmi.univ-mrs.fr
Tue Sep 8 17:16:15 CEST 2009
sorry, the trace of the debuuger output:
(dbx) where
current thread: t at 2
=>[1] FT_Set_Transform(0x58e400, 0x7d479630, 0x0, 0x0, 0x0, 0x0), at
0x7ec8943c
[2] _cairo_ft_unscaled_font_set_scale(0x5b6458, 0x0, 0x0, 0x10000,
0x0, 0x7ede13b8), at 0x7ede1614
[3] _cairo_ft_scaled_font_create(0x5b6458, 0x5b6528, 0x975390,
0x975418, 0x7d479ac8, 0x0), at 0x7ede2f04
[4] _cairo_ft_font_face_scaled_font_create(0x0, 0x0, 0x0, 0x7d479ac8,
0x7d479a64, 0x0), at 0x7ede4184
[5] cairo_scaled_font_create(0x190f38, 0x975390, 0x975418,
0x7d479ac8, 0x5b6528, 0x5c52c), at 0x7edb2660
[6] _cairo_gstate_ensure_scaled_font(0x975340, 0x9753d0, 0x5ad89c,
0x0, 0x62b4c, 0x5ad898), at 0x7ed988e0
[7] _cairo_gstate_show_text_glyphs(0x0, 0x0, 0x0, 0x1fb600, 0x6,
0x0), at 0x7ed98ad8
[8] cairo_show_glyphs(0x6135d8, 0x7, 0x6, 0x14, 0x1fb678, 0x0), at
0x7ed90978
[9] CairoOutputDev::endString(0x5ac480, 0x621d20, 0x0, 0x0, 0x0,
0x1fa660), at 0x7f41a480
[10] Gfx::doShowText(0x233d58, 0x647680, 0x1, 0x80, 0x72, 0x61d3c8),
at 0x7db15c70
[11] Gfx::opShowSpaceText(0x233d58, 0x5, 0x621d20, 0x10d128,
0x7dc21bdc, 0x0), at 0x7db14cf4
[12] Gfx::go(0x233d58, 0x7dc35428, 0x1, 0x7db14a60, 0x7d47b810,
0x224d48), at 0x7db03728
[13] Gfx::display(0x233d58, 0x7d47bb68, 0x1, 0x7f4195e0, 0x5a6d68,
0x204380), at 0x7db0325c
[14] Page::displaySlice(0x972188, 0x5ac480, 0x225400, 0xffffffff,
0xffffffff, 0xffffffff), at 0x7db63fe4
[15] poppler_page_render(0x2195b8, 0x0, 0x219fa8, 0x1, 0x262d8,
0x219fa8), at 0x7f413bd0
[16] 0x77c60(0x6246f0, 0x2308c8, 0x0, 0x6135d8, 0x7e3e8fd0, 0x41d),
at 0x77c60
[17] ev_document_render(0x219590, 0x2308c8, 0x3c00, 0x3868, 0x2217c8,
0x3800), at 0x70d6c
[18] ev_job_render_run(0x16bb38, 0x1d4700, 0x2007, 0x258d8,
0x7e3e816c, 0x1), at 0x2c398
[19] 0x2a5ec(0x16bb38, 0x1, 0x29c00, 0xa5400, 0xa4800, 0xa4ab8), at
0x2a5ec
[20] g_thread_create_proxy(0xd3c10, 0x7e31c4c8, 0x7e31c4c8, 0x2a1e0,
0xa557c, 0x7e31c4b0), at 0x7e276cfc
mombasa-henry% pkginfo -l CSWftype2
VERSION: 2.3.8,REV=2009.02.16
mombasa-henry% pkginfo -l CSWlibcairo
PKGINST: CSWlibcairo
VERSION: 1.8.6,REV=2009.06.25
mombasa-henry% pkginfo -l CSWpoppler
VERSION: 0.8.0,REV=2008.04.12
Gerard Henry wrote:
> running with the debugger dbx, it says:
> t at 2 (l at 2) signal SEGV (no mapping at the fault address) in
> FT_Set_Transform at 0x7ec8943c
> 0x7ec8943c: FT_Set_Transform+0x0014: clr [%g4 + 28]
>
> it seems to bee related with freetype
> i found this:
> https://bugs.launchpad.net/ubuntu/+source/freetype/+bug/148952
>
> but it seems that newer releases has corrected it.
>
> Gerard Henry wrote:
>> hello all,
>> on solaris 10, with the latest packages, i have a serious problem when
>> using evince, after several refreshes (CTRL-R):
>> mombasa-henry% ptree 15921
>> 2290 /usr/dt/bin/dtlogin -daemon
>> 4663 /usr/dt/bin/dtlogin -daemon
>> 29840 /bin/ksh /usr/dt/bin/Xsession
>> 29950 /usr/dt/bin/sdt_shell -c unsetenv _ PWD; source
>> /home/henry/.l
>> 29953 tcsh -c unsetenv _ PWD; source /home/henry/.login;
>> 29978 /usr/dt/bin/dtsession
>> 29987 gnome-terminal
>> 15145 tcsh
>> 15921 /opt/csw/bin/evince existence.pdf
>> 15935 /opt/csw/libexec/gnome_segv evince 11 2.20.2
>> 15939 sh -c /opt/csw/bin/bug-buddy
>> --appname="evince" --pid
>> 15940 /opt/csw/bin/bug-buddy --appname=evince
>> --pid=15921
>>
>>
>> mombasa-henry% pstack 15921
>> 15921: /opt/csw/bin/evince existence.pdf
>> ----------------- lwp# 1 / thread# 1 --------------------
>> fdd20368 _XFlushInt (acc80, 0, ff000000, 133dcc, 0, fde54000) + 140
>> fdd29270 _XEventsQueued (acc80, 2, ff000000, 12adac, c76b8, fde54000)
>> + 28
>> fdd29208 XPending (acc80, 0, 0, 1c00, 0, 0) + 4c
>> fe74fff0 gdk_event_check (c7668, 2c, 0, 0, 5415c, 1) + 60
>> fda44568 g_main_context_check (c76b0, 7fffffff, c7668, ddcfc, c76b8,
>> a55a0) + 2d8
>> fda44dcc g_main_context_iterate (c76b0, 1, 1, 7, ffbfebd0, 213ba0) + 4b4
>> fda4572c g_main_loop_run (238088, 1, ca930, fdb0fc80, 0, ae420) + 3e0
>> fe13c8e4 gtk_main (30, 169200, fe7a6984, 0, fe41d8a8, 238088) + d8
>> 0005d054 main (2, ffbfed7c, 0, 0, 8e284, b182c) + 714
>> 00026688 _start (0, 0, 0, 0, 0, 0) + 108
>> ----------------- lwp# 2 / thread# 2 --------------------
>> fd74ad7c waitid (0, 3e3f, fccf8e40, 3)
>> fd73a704 waitpid (3e3f, fccf8fa4, 0, 0, fd7c3800, fcda0a00) + 60
>> ff26070c ???????? (b, 1, 43434, 0, ff2a9fb8, ff2a3a5c)
>> fd746e78 __sighndlr (b, 0, fccf9188, ff260618, 0, 1) + c
>> fd73b558 call_user_handler (b, 0, 0, 0, fcda0a00, fccf9188) + 3b8
>> fd73b72c sigacthandler (b, 0, fccf9188, 0, fcda0a00, 0) + 4c
>> --- called from signal handler with signal 11 (SIGSEGV) ---
>> fe48943c FT_Set_Transform (6507d0, 0, 0, 10000, 0, fe5e13b8) + 14
>> fe5e2f04 _cairo_ft_scaled_font_create (6507d0, 212d10, 5cc2d8,
>> 5cc360, fccf9ac8, 0) + cc
>> fe5e4184 _cairo_ft_font_face_scaled_font_create (0, 0, 0, fccf9ac8,
>> fccf9a64, 0) + 4c
>> fe5b2660 cairo_scaled_font_create (18eff8, 5cc2d8, 5cc360, fccf9ac8,
>> 212d10, 5c52c) + 2c8
>> fe5988e0 _cairo_gstate_ensure_scaled_font (5cc288, 5cc318, 9bcbe4, 0,
>> 62b4c, 9bcbe0) + 5c
>> fe598ad8 _cairo_gstate_show_text_glyphs (0, 0, 0, 63c080, 3, 0) + 60
>> fe590978 cairo_show_glyphs (c87860, 7, 3, 8, 63c0b0, 0) + 5c
>> fec1a480 __1cOCairoOutputDevJendString6MpnIGfxState__v_ (5c0178,
>> 60c710, 0, 0, 0, 649cb8) + 60
>> fd315c70 __1cDGfxKdoShowText6MpnJGooString__v_ (5a9888, 639a10, 1,
>> 80, 69, 5b7780) + eb0
>> fd314cf4 __1cDGfxPopShowSpaceText6MpnGObject_i_v_ (5a9888, 23,
>> 60c710, 10d128, fd421bdc, 0) + 294
>> fd303728 __1cDGfxCgo6Mi_v_ (5a9888, fd435428, 1, fd314a60, fccfb810,
>> 654f58) + 428
>> fd30325c __1cDGfxHdisplay6MpnGObject_i_v_ (5a9888, fccfbb68, 1,
>> fec195e0, 1e74c0, 58ed00) + 11c
>> fd363fe4
>> __1cEPageMdisplaySlice6MpnJOutputDev_ddiiiiiiiipnHCatalog_pFpv_i5pFpnFAnnot_5_i5_v_
>> (5f6178, 5c0178, 236f18, ffffffff, ffffffff, ffffffff) + 164
>> fec13bd0 poppler_page_render (237078, 0, 23fac0, 1, 262d8, 23fac0) + d0
>> 00077c60 ???????? (1dee08, 1f9e50, 0, c87860, fdbe8fd0, 41d)
>> 00070d6c ev_document_render (237050, 1f9e50, 3c00, 3868, 23e548,
>> 3800) + cc
>> 0002c398 ev_job_render_run (16b4d0, 272ba8, 2007, 258d8, fdbe816c, 1)
>> + 118
>> 0002a5ec ???????? (16b4d0, 1, 29c00, a5400, a4800, a4ab8)
>> fda76cfc g_thread_create_proxy (d3bc0, fdb1c4c8, fdb1c4c8, 2a1e0,
>> a557c, fdb1c4b0) + 188
>> fd746d4c _lwp_start (0, 0, 0, 0, 0, 0)
>>
>>
>> anybody has seen this problem?
>>
>> thanks
>>
>> gerard
>> _______________________________________________
>> users mailing list
>> users at lists.opencsw.org
>> https://lists.opencsw.org/mailman/listinfo/users
>
> _______________________________________________
> users mailing list
> users at lists.opencsw.org
> https://lists.opencsw.org/mailman/listinfo/users
More information about the users
mailing list